计算机视觉模型高效部署工具链构建指南
|
构建计算机视觉模型高效部署工具链是将模型从训练阶段过渡到实际应用的关键步骤。这不仅涉及模型的优化,还包括硬件适配、推理加速以及系统集成等多个方面。 在工具链设计初期,需要明确目标应用场景。不同的场景对模型性能、延迟和资源消耗的要求各不相同,例如移动端与边缘设备的部署需求就与服务器端存在显著差异。 选择合适的模型框架是基础。主流的深度学习框架如TensorFlow、PyTorch等提供了丰富的工具支持,但还需考虑其在目标平台上的兼容性和性能表现。 模型压缩和量化技术能够有效降低计算和存储需求。通过剪枝、量化或知识蒸馏等方式,可以在保持精度的前提下提升模型的运行效率。
AI生成内容图,仅供参考 部署过程中需关注硬件特性。GPU、NPU或专用AI芯片的使用会显著影响推理速度,因此需要针对不同硬件进行优化,例如利用CUDA或OpenVINO等工具提升计算效率。 同时,工具链应具备良好的可扩展性。随着模型迭代和新硬件的出现,工具链需要灵活适应变化,避免因架构调整而造成大量重复工作。 测试与监控是确保部署稳定性的关键环节。通过性能基准测试和实时监控,可以及时发现并解决潜在问题,保障系统的长期可靠运行。 (编辑:91站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

